Instrument highlights
Litesizer DIF 500 offers advanced particle sizing from 10 nm to 3.5 mm, drawing on nearly 60 years of laser diffraction expertise. It boasts a best-in-class optical setup featuring powerful 10 mW and 25 mW lasers and the widest range on the market of detected diffraction angles from 0.01°to 170°.
The Kalliope software simplifies particle sizing, requiring no extensive training – measurements start with just three clicks. The Quick-Click system allows easy switching between dispersion units, minimizing errors. Safety features for both liquid and dry dispersion ensure effortless, secure operation.
The robust metal housing and the isolated optical bench ensure reliability everywhere: from harsh environments, to high-tech laboratories.
